Kings Canyon in Central Australia - a relatively new tourist route. Locals there is practically no, and normal road appeared only 20 years ago. The canyon walls rise up to 300 meters, and form a veritable maze of rock through which passes several hiking trails.
However, before you embark on any of the tracks, it is necessary to overcome the steep climb. Local Aborigines call it Heartbreak Hill, and the development of tourism, he received a new name - the Hill of a heart attack ...
As the Canyon is located more than 300 kilometers from Uluru (where we settled), the trip had gone all day. We left at 4 am and went for a long time on the bus: the first stop happened in some ranch at 7 am, where we stopped for breakfast:
A walk through the canyon provides two variants - light version of half a kilometer, and hard, 6 km. We went to the second, since so many have passed:

Here is shown the formation of the canyon: first, a crack in the rock, which eventually grows to an enormous size. Theoretically, through all these huge gorge could jump at the beginning of their origin:
The stone that was once a seabed. The water dried up, rock rose and turned to stone. Guides is being touted as a "tan-long 2 million years":
